The CSM has extended the deadline for completing the online questionnaire about the judicial system until December 21, 2025, following criticisms of the initiative.

The Superior Council of Magistracy (CSM) announced that it has extended the deadline for completing the online questionnaire for judges, extending it until December 21, 2025. The initiative aims to consult the professional body of judges on current issues in the judicial system.


Criticism has come from Stelian Ion, former Minister of Justice, who argued that the questionnaire is not an open research, but a way to validate a convenient narrative about the crisis in justice. Ion warned that the distribution of the questionnaire could exert pressure on magistrates.


On December 22, President Nicușor Dan will hold a meeting at Cotroceni with magistrates dissatisfied with the functioning of the justice system.
